def _as_cloud_outage_reason(value: object) -> CloudOutageReason | None:
    """Narrow a snapshot value to a cloud outage reason literal."""
    if isinstance(value, str) and value in get_args(CloudOutageReason):
        # Membership against ``get_args(CloudOutageReason)`` is the guard; cast only
        # tells mypy the Literal union after that runtime check.
        return cast(CloudOutageReason, value)
    return None


def _cloud_outage_reason_from_source(source: CloudSessionSource) -> CloudOutageReason:
    """Map a session flip source to a persisted outage reason.

    ``stop`` stays ``stop``. ``disconnect`` and ``connect`` both become
    ``disconnect`` — ``connect`` appears on the restore path as a fallback when
    no prior reason was stored; outage reasons themselves never include ``connect``.
    """
    if source == "stop":
        return "stop"
    return "disconnect"
